225 Optimax Shaft Length Conversion Cost
I’m trying to determine Ball Park cost to go from XXL to L for my Optimax, assuming fair price on used parts, machining, etc. Any ideas? Thanks.
-
03-26-2018, 05:57 PM #2
can, driveshaft replaced or shortened, shift shaft replaced or shortened, water tube replaced or shortened, power head gasket, labor if you cant do it your self. Gotta put a new or used price to everything. Might be able to find a can for around $400, probably most expensive part. If you have to have someone replace shaft thats the other hit the rest is fairly inexpensive unless of course the power head doesnt want to cooperate

03-27-2018, 07:37 PM #7
I switched an EFI XL to a L. It was fairly simple. Like the others said. The midsection is gonna be the most expensive. I found one on Ebay when i did it. It cost me about 650$ but had the trim and exhaust housing with it. No tubes to have to cut or anything. The shaft is probably in 2 different pieces. Its gotta coupler connecting the two. You can order the shaft online and is prob cheaper than getting yours re-splined. Keep your mid and sell it. Can get some of the money back. Just make sure the bolts on the mid arent rusted up bad when you buy one.

$650 for an opti 20" can? You were blessed. I was happy to pay $1200 for mine. But it did come with a tuner. Better figure about 1k for a used 20" can. Just in case you don't know there are new style and old style cans for the 3 liter. The old style ones are easy to find and cheap but a nice newer style is expensive snd hard to find.
